Carbon Filter Installation in San Antonio, TX
Carbon filter installation services are designed to improve indoor air quality by removing odors, pollutants, and airborne contaminants through specialized filtration systems. These services are often requested for projects such as upgrading existing ventilation systems, installing new air purification units, or addressing persistent odors from cooking, pets, or household activities. Homeowners typically want to understand the types of filters available, how they integrate with current HVAC setups, and what maintenance is involved to ensure continued effectiveness.
Property owners considering carbon filter installation should evaluate the size and layout of their space, as well as specific concerns like odor control or air purity. It’s important to clarify whether the system will be integrated into existing ductwork or standalone units, and to understand the expected lifespan and replacement needs of the filters. Asking about the compatibility with current systems and the overall benefits can help determine the best solution for maintaining a healthier indoor environment.

Carbon Filter Installation Questions
What is a carbon filter used for? A carbon filter helps remove odors, gases, and airborne contaminants from indoor air or water systems, improving overall air and water quality.
Where can a carbon filter be installed? Carbon filters can be installed in HVAC systems, kitchen ventilation, water purification units, and other areas requiring air or water filtration.
How often should a carbon filter be replaced? Replacement frequency depends on usage, but generally, filters should be checked every few months for optimal performance.
What types of property projects typically require carbon filter installation? Properties experiencing persistent odors, indoor air quality issues, or water contamination concerns often benefit from carbon filter installation.
